3rd Instalment of The Soiree Ft. Lloyiso, Elaine & AKA

in Entertainment
Reading Time: 2 min
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

To celebrate Valentine’s Day and the month of love, the popular new lifestyle & music event series, The Soirée by Stella Artois, returns to Johannesburg on February 18th, with The Lovers’ Edition at picturesque Toadbury Hall Country Hotel near Lanseria.

In this, the third installment of The Soirée, eventgoers can expect a stellar music line-up with a distinctive Afro-soul leaning, and love at the center of all things lyrical, including SAMA award-winning artists Elaine, Lloyiso, Amanda Black and AKA, as well as house DJ Marcus Harvey, DJ Loveslavephola, DJ & mixologist, Mmisology, and funk DJ, Sumthin Brown.

Lloyiso has been working on a new collaboration with Grammy award-winning UK electronic group, Clean Bandit, which is expected to be released soon while, having recently returned from the US (where her face adorned billboards on New York’s Times Square), Elaine is also currently working on her debut album. Multi award-winning and platinum selling Afro-soul artist, Amanda Black, is well known for her socially conscious songs while AKA will be releasing a much-anticipated new album, ‘Mass Country’.

“I can’t wait to perform at The Soirée which has become an important platform for bringing people together in deep and meaningful connections. I can’t wait to share my latest body of work and what better place to do so than in the month of love,” says Lloyiso.

The Soirée by Stella Artois Lovers’ Edition starts at noon and ends at 9pm on February 18th. To purchase tickets, go to Howler.
